Have you considered
Fusion E350? It's very energy efficient and
reasonably inexpensive.
If that lacks enough processing oomph for you, an affordable Socket-AM3 solution with integrated graphics should suffice, though it will use a bit more power.
Here are some micro-ATX socket-AM3 motherboards with the 880G+SB850 chipset and USB3:
$95 MSI 880GMA-E45
$97½ MSI 880GMA-E35
$105 Gigabyte GA-880GMA-USB3
$105 Asus M4A88TD-M/USB3
$108 MSI 880GMA-E55
Stick a cheap
Athlon II X2 255 or
Athlon II X3 450 processor on there, add 2x2 or 2x4 GiB of
PC3-12800 or PC3-10600 memory, and you should be well on your way.
Sandy Bridge on LGA1155 would be more energy efficient, but it costs a lot more, too. Matching the
Core i3-2100T with the
P8H67-M PRO/CSM or a combination of
Core i3-2100 + H67 motherboard would be good examples.
You could also do well with an older Clarkdale processor on LGA1156. Pair up the
Core i3-550 with the
GA-H55M-USB3, for example, but it's not really any cheaper than the superior Sandy Bridge options.
